Received: by 2002:a05:6a10:9e8c:0:0:0:0 with SMTP id y12csp2761639pxx; Sun, 1 Nov 2020 09:03:56 -0800 (PST) X-Google-Smtp-Source: ABdhPJzSzpEAcSqQhxmo6GT8EQdj4StsknlLMIkDEg2jU0RUm4XPuNOpz2D0TVjPgIUycr4A1+sg X-Received: by 2002:a05:6402:10c7:: with SMTP id p7mr12779848edu.34.1604250236320; Sun, 01 Nov 2020 09:03:56 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1604250236; cv=none; d=google.com; s=arc-20160816; b=HetQ0SwGEaF3S/OAdL0mDN47cVWG+0uAtYDLwxdd+KcdLGfCx0D4ZKJ5RcPEDiBSx7 eseKyQQna8J9uY3a32Z0sSYj2kj28tbLbeq5S6HdsSo55gkEXx29NZ18AdoqjwHJJpB/ o6uAENbNy4F54PqcvUkJUOlpNJTXw5c78HICfpLCjvrrWMebcDyHT+SKLbnreIdzLUFs X/D7VSF+4YKvlgJ+Xehxb7H84SVBrkwESogE3oev6os3hmyEbnYtLwAxvwq2J5R72ea4 rZvCDrHJq8QeRww8EBq1Pc1qNFaIA4V29LECPZnP87AA5s4FOW5jl2/WUlMag6om9Ysf jLnA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:robot-unsubscribe :robot-id:message-id:mime-version:references:in-reply-to:cc:subject :to:reply-to:sender:from:dkim-signature:dkim-signature:date; bh=z24KCw26SI/i8tvtphq2lnupjg7U+HCKvoU06qTriQg=; b=H6Piglhg61BnGQ/l8H1cbMnzusdmi5ZHyOXrtzn0yT5ashg/GW1zjBnWskeEH46liN EkEtIUSzV2NHMae6XNH5+8R85OK2RdRnDiPJOQCaEHqmnwprMzsCjiUKDvBo1r8jemek 0TM9A1sQL4xlVpG67cF3x8f0IepJY01HIYsMExdrNBJeIo0XJZKizYPEv2eb/viUSXpt +VBH2it/ciNjD/7xMEJIcbR4Vwdbp7YLoEXIdGTOyUxc8jhlfuAbO+o+QfCjbk86GG/i SUx0+ktWyE7ULD7ko4rgDZIw6J+suBYUjz5TmLM8zSG4PysLmOd0xkrvMw8RPWwbW5x9 CPSw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linutronix.de header.s=2020 header.b=3QmrRb7+; dkim=neutral (no key) header.i=@linutronix.de;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=linutronix.de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id f23si8801028ejb.6.2020.11.01.09.03.33; Sun, 01 Nov 2020 09:03:56 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@linutronix.de header.s=2020 header.b=3QmrRb7+; dkim=neutral (no key) header.i=@linutronix.de;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=linutronix.de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727033AbgKARAL (ORCPT + 99 others); Sun, 1 Nov 2020 12:00:11 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:48360 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726866AbgKARAL (ORCPT ); Sun, 1 Nov 2020 12:00:11 -0500 Received: from galois.linutronix.de (Galois.linutronix.de [IPv6:2a0a:51c0:0:12e:550::1]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id EAE57C061A04; Sun, 1 Nov 2020 09:00:10 -0800 (PST) Date: Sun, 01 Nov 2020 17:00:07 -0000 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linutronix.de; s=2020; t=1604250008; h=from:from:sender:sender:reply-to: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=z24KCw26SI/i8tvtphq2lnupjg7U+HCKvoU06qTriQg=; b=3QmrRb7+R7F67tnDnaIR+maUjAd4vEZu3wlv7OJAEA8yLpUFxE35OWouM55z+Of69h45eQ NDE6aNqjhGqPDh6mLzm5wyrehT801I1p34CKtfjQwz/nPjzsl8jhgP6/Sd6JmCX+WixfzV wqilVs83V+Xa+YajWjWHK6EB/repxFwGX/GV5TzmeUoGc4C2kKb4d9TIKPk2tlfgDlruLA 3Yi3kYBb4G71km8XRRPNKDaVoy5jHIjkesA7Ocl3PFvLJEHnCDfpNYiqERNO+73OKgjCuK gNwxqjU8A0+o+HenUxEn9f1k/T7pMc/tT/+Y3fJWgd+9hPxnapf3tj/qW85tzw== DKIM-Signature: v=1; a=ed25519-sha256; c=relaxed/relaxed; d=linutronix.de; s=2020e; t=1604250008; h=from:from:sender:sender:reply-to: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=z24KCw26SI/i8tvtphq2lnupjg7U+HCKvoU06qTriQg=; b=24o1yqgBqrBFz/ZnU1HDKpkVP61H9a6JHJekICkzKaUkIWw6E8F3/Xx2IeTwlpKZ1qOkyo tv/IVyRmXNs4OvBA== From: "tip-bot2 for Peter Ujfalusi" Sender: tip-bot2@linutronix.de Reply-to: linux-kernel@vger.kernel.org To: linux-tip-commits@vger.kernel.org Subject: [tip: irq/urgent] dt-bindings: irqchip: ti, sci-inta: Update for unmapped event handling Cc: Peter Ujfalusi , Marc Zyngier , Rob Herring , x86 , LKML In-Reply-To: <20201020073243.19255-2-peter.ujfalusi@ti.com> References: <20201020073243.19255-2-peter.ujfalusi@ti.com> MIME-Version: 1.0 Message-ID: <160425000793.397.16218233475336649509.tip-bot2@tip-bot2> Robot-ID: Robot-Unsubscribe: Contact to get blacklisted from these emails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org The following commit has been merged into the irq/urgent branch of tip: Commit-ID: bb2bd7c7f3d0946acc2104db31df228d10f7b598 Gitweb: https://git.kernel.org/tip/bb2bd7c7f3d0946acc2104db31df228d10f7b598 Author: Peter Ujfalusi AuthorDate: Tue, 20 Oct 2020 10:32:42 +03:00 Committer: Marc Zyngier CommitterDate: Sun, 01 Nov 2020 12:00:50 dt-bindings: irqchip: ti, sci-inta: Update for unmapped event handling The new DMA architecture introduced with AM64 introduced new event types: unampped events. These events are mapped within INTA in contrast to other K3 devices where the events with similar function was originating from the UDMAP or ringacc. The ti,unmapped-event-sources should contain phandle array to the devices in the system (typically DMA controllers) from where the unmapped events originate. Signed-off-by: Peter Ujfalusi Signed-off-by: Marc Zyngier Reviewed-by: Rob Herring Link: https://lore.kernel.org/r/20201020073243.19255-2-peter.ujfalusi@ti.com --- Documentation/devicetree/bindings/interrupt-controller/ti,sci-inta.yaml |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/Documentation/devicetree/bindings/interrupt-controller/ti,sci-inta.yaml b/Documentation/devicetree/bindings/interrupt-controller/ti,sci-inta.yaml index c7cd056..cc79549 100644 --- a/Documentation/devicetree/bindings/interrupt-controller/ti,sci-inta.yaml +++ b/Documentation/devicetree/bindings/interrupt-controller/ti,sci-inta.yaml @@ -32,6 +32,11 @@ description: | | | vint | bit | | 0 |.....|63| vintx | | +--------------+ +------------+ | | | + | Unmap | + | +--------------+ | + Unmapped events ----->| | umapidx |-------------------------> Globalevents + | +--------------+ | + | | +-----------------------------------------+ Configuration of these Intmap registers that maps global events to vint is @@ -70,6 +75,11 @@ properties: - description: | "limit" specifies the limit for translation + ti,unmapped-event-sources: + $ref: /schemas/types.yaml#definitions/phandle-array + description: + Array of phandles to DMA controllers where the unmapped events originate. + required: - compatible - reg